Well, we've now seen the Automatic Runner. Designed to be used in extra innings, but with the score tied at 3 at the end of 8, they had San Diego put a runner on 2B to start the 9th in this game.

The Managers agreed to do it in the 9th to try to avoid extra innings.

The runner was the batting position which made the last out the previous inning. And the Padres drove him home to take the lead. And had three walks as well. For those of you keeping score, you put "E" (for error), but not charge the team or a player with an error.

As we go to the bottom of the 9th, the D-backs start out with a runner on 2B -- the defensive replacement for the outfielder who made the last out in the 8th.

So the D-backs are down by 1 in the bottom of the 9th with the Automatic Runner on 2B.
